Abstract
There is disclosed a test apparatus for use in a wireless network base station comprising a non-radio unit for processing baseband signals and a radio unit separate from the non-radio unit for transmitting and receiving radio frequency (RF) signals. The test apparatus comprises: 1) a housing; 2) a first connector coupled via a first cable to the radio unit, wherein the first cable comprises signal lines carrying base station signals between the radio unit and the non-radio unit; 3) a second connector coupled via a second cable to the non-radio unit, wherein the second cable comprises signal lines carrying the base station signals between the radio unit and the non-radio unit; and 4) a first access connector that allows a signal measuring device to monitor at least one of the base station signals.
